Glossary
10BASE-T IEEE802.3 specification for 10 Mbps Ethernet over twisted pair wiring.
100BASE-Tx IEEE802.3 specification for 100 Mbps Ethernet over twisted pair wiring.
CAT5 Category5. An Electronic Industry Association (EIA) rating for twisted pair
cablethat meets specified loss and crosstalk requirements for high-speed
networking.The cable rating is printed on the cable jacket.
DHCP See DynamicHost Configuration Protocol.
DNS See Domain Name Server.
DomainName Se rver A DomainName Server (DNS) resolves descriptive names of network
resources(such as www.netgear.com) to numeric IP addresses.
DynamicHost
Configuration
Protocol
AnEthernet protocol that provides a centralized administration point for
assigningnetwork configuration information.
IP See InternetProtocol.
IPAddress A4-byte number uniquely defining each host on the Internet. Ranges of
addressesare assigned by Internic, an organization formed for this purpose.
Usually written in dotted-decimal notation with periods separating the bytes
(forexample, 134.177.244.57).
IPSec InternetProtocol Security. IPSec is a series of guidelines for securing private
information transmitted over public networks. IPSec is a VPN method
providinga higher level of security than PPTP.
IPX See InternetPacket Exchange.
ISP Internetservice provider.
Internet Packet
Exchange Novell’sinternetworking protocol.
